Output ddeeb74dfa66ea33f2e2a57d4ec7a8da2ae18c437bbd3f2635851b80973f8403:1

value
6665900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f4b904ad4318cdd22ff812776d5986c4c091bbc OP_EQUAL
address
335tag7Euz2fpr9ErH95cYzGW5MiUyR7iq
transaction
ddeeb74dfa66ea33f2e2a57d4ec7a8da2ae18c437bbd3f2635851b80973f8403
confirmations
334260
spent
true